Camden to cyclists: 'Get on the road!'

City officials and police in Camdem, UK are warning cyclists to stay off of the sidewalks and ride on the road where they belong. "The fact is that it is extremely dangerous to ride bikes on the pavement," says Kentish Town ward councillor Lucy Anderson.

"There have been so many accidents outside my shop with cyclists crashing into pedestrians," according to Jake Morgan, of Morgan's Stationery, Kentish Town Road.

Note to our American readers: "Pavement" is UK-speak for "sidewalk."
